THE ALMOST TEAM UP WITH HOT TOPIC
TO CREATE A NEW FAN-FRIENDLY WAY TO EXPERIENCE MUSIC
WITH EXCLUSIVE LIMITED EDITION EP -OUT TODAY, OCT. 6

October 6, 2009

LOS ANGELES, CA -The Almost's (Tooth & Nail/Virgin/EMI) album Monster Monster doesn't come out until Nov. 3, but the band and label have partnered with lifestyle retailer Hot Topic in an innovative promotion for the Oct. 6 release of a limited edition, five-track EP, that will be available exclusively at the Hot Topic, the band's website (http://www.thealmostmerch.com/) and on the group's upcoming tour. The package will include the full length packaging for Monster Monster, two CDs, one of music (three album cuts and two b-sides) and a second blank disc to download the full album with a promotional code the day of release (11/3) from Hot Topic website ShockHound.com. "This is a great innovative way to create a continuous fan-friendly music experience, while redefining how consumers purchase music," adds Greg Thompson, EVP of Marketing & Promotion for EMI North America.

As another bonus for fans, The Almost will preview their new lead, anthemic rock single, "Hands" today (10/6), at www.myspace.com/thealmost.

The Almost:
Formed by Underoath drummer Aaron Gillespie along with guitarists Jay Vilardi and Dusty Redmon, bassist Alex Aponte and newest member, drummer Joe Musten. Monster Monster is the follow-up album to their major label debut, Southern Weather, which debuted at #39 on Billboard's Top 200, earned them a Top 10 single at Alternative radio, and a spot on MTV's Discover & Download, was essentially the work of a single individual-Underoath drummer Aaron Gillespie, who wrote all the songs, played all the instruments. Monster Monster represents the culmination of two years of touring, which melded the group's individual talents into a truly collaborative effort.
